What are motels like?
Motels often offer free parking, and many also include an outdoor pool. Often one or two stories tall, motel properties usually have exterior corridors overlooking the parking lot or an outdoor pool. In the U.S., motels became more commonplace at the end of the 1940s with the popularity of car travel and road trips, peaking in the 1960s with over 60,000 properties.

What things can I to do in Takatsuki?
Favorite places in and around Takatsuki include Kiyomizu Temple, Osaka Castle, and Dotonbori. These are some of the parks and outdoorsy places: Settsukyo Park, Shofuen, and Akutagawa Park. You’ll find these family-friendly sights in the area: Universal Studios Japan, Osaka Aquarium Kaiyukan, and Hirakata Park. During your trip, here are some other places to visit: ROUND1 STADIUM Takatsuki, Imashirotsuka Ancient History Museum, and Historic Haniwa Factory Park.
What's the seasonal weather like in Takatsuki?
Weather can make or break a roadtrip, so we’ve gathered some data about year-round temperatures in Takatsuki to help you plan yours. The hottest months are usually August and July with an average temp of 76°F, while the coldest months are January and February with an average of 42°F. The rainiest months in Takatsuki are July, June, September, and October, with each month seeing an average of 8 inches of rainfall.
What are my options for getting around Takatsuki when staying in a motel?
We’ve gathered some information about local transportation options in Takatsuki to help you navigate your stay: Fly into Itami Airport (ITM), which is located 11.3 mi (18.2 km) away from the heart of the city. Otherwise, you can search for flights to Kobe Airport (UKB), which is 27.3 mi (43.9 km) away. Metro stations nearby include Takatsuki-shi Station and Tonda Station. If you want to see more of the area, hop aboard a train from Takatsuki Station, Kammaki Station, or Settsu-Tonda Station.
